Configure Private
LAN Addresses
To configure TCP/IP network information for the private LAN
connection (LAN 2):
1. Press ENTER, at the management server LCD panel, press
ENTER. The Welcome!! or operational information message
changes to an Input Password 0**** message.
2. Using the button to increment a digit, the button to
decrement a digit, the button to move the cursor left, and the
button to move the cursor right, input the default or changed
password, and press ENTER. The LAN 1 Setting?? message
appears at the LCD panel.
3. Press the button. The LAN 2 Setting?? message appears at the
LCD panel. Press ENTER and the default IP address of 10.1.1.1
appears.
4. Use the arrow keys as described in step 2 to input a new IP
address, then press ENTER. A Save Change? Yes, Save!! message
appears.
5. Press ENTER. The LAN 2 IP address changes and the default
subnet mask of 255.0.0.0 appears.
6. Use the arrow keys as described in step 2 to input a new subnet
mask, then press ENTER. A Save Change? Yes, Save!! message
appears.
7. Press ENTER. A Wait a moment! message appears at the LCD
panel, the panel returns to the LAN 1 Setting?? message, and the
LAN 2 subnet mask changes.
8. Record the private LAN IP address and subnet mask for reference
if the server hard drive fails and must be restored.
